Wildly Styled Matrix Debuts at Long Beach Grand Prix
With help from the boys over at Integraf Decals, Longo Toyota, Cord Automotive, Progressive, and Motegi, BC Ethic Clothing company has put together a tuner car that has definite, if not blatant, hints of hot rod style. Premiering at Toyota’s Grand Prix of Long Beach, the BC Ethic Special Edition will take a limited tour around SoCal before heading back to Longo Toyota, to be snatched up by some lucky driver.
